요세미티가 도메인 이름을 확인할 수 없음


16

그래서 나는 mDNSResponder요세미티에서 애플이 제거 되었다는 것을 알고 있지만 많은 앱들이 여전히 애플과 상호 작용하고 실패하고있는 것으로 보입니다.

Oct 20 10:57:00 Nicks-MacBook-Pro.local configd[25]: dnssd_clientstub ConnectToServer: connect() failed path:/var/run/mDNSResponder Socket:8 Err:-1 Errno:61 Connection refused
Oct 20 10:57:03 Nicks-MacBook-Pro.local ntpd[239]: dnssd_clientstub ConnectToServer: connect() failed path:/var/run/mDNSResponder Socket:3 Err:-1 Errno:61 Connection refused
Oct 20 10:57:03 Nicks-MacBook-Pro.local Spotify[604]: dnssd_clientstub ConnectToServer: connect() failed path:/var/run/mDNSResponder Socket:88 Err:-1 Errno:61 Connection refused
Oct 20 10:57:04 Nicks-MacBook-Pro.local configd[25]: dnssd_clientstub ConnectToServer: connect() failed path:/var/run/mDNSResponder Socket:8 Err:-1 Errno:61 Connection refused
Oct 20 10:57:06 Nicks-MacBook-Pro.local ntpd[239]: dnssd_clientstub ConnectToServer: connect() failed path:/var/run/mDNSResponder Socket:3 Err:-1 Errno:61 Connection refused
Oct 20 10:57:07 Nicks-MacBook-Pro.local configd[25]: dnssd_clientstub ConnectToServer: connect() failed path:/var/run/mDNSResponder Socket:8 Err:-1 Errno:61 Connection refused
Oct 20 10:57:09 Nicks-MacBook-Pro.local ntpd[239]: dnssd_clientstub ConnectToServer: connect() failed path:/var/run/mDNSResponder Socket:3 Err:-1 Errno:61 Connection refused
Oct 20 10:57:10 Nicks-MacBook-Pro.local configd[25]: dnssd_clientstub ConnectToServer: connect() failed path:/var/run/mDNSResponder Socket:8 Err:-1 Errno:61 Connection refused
Oct 20 10:57:12 Nicks-MacBook-Pro.local ntpd[239]: dnssd_clientstub ConnectToServer: connect() failed path:/var/run/mDNSResponder Socket:3 Err:-1 Errno:61 Connection refused
Oct 20 10:57:13 Nicks-MacBook-Pro.local configd[25]: dnssd_clientstub ConnectToServer: connect() failed path:/var/run/mDNSResponder Socket:8 Err:-1 Errno:61 Connection refused
Oct 20 10:57:15 Nicks-MacBook-Pro.local ntpd[239]: dnssd_clientstub ConnectToServer: connect() failed path:/var/run/mDNSResponder Socket:3 Err:-1 Errno:61 Connection refused
Oct 20 10:57:16 Nicks-MacBook-Pro.local configd[25]: dnssd_clientstub ConnectToServer: connect() failed path:/var/run/mDNSResponder Socket:8 Err:-1 Errno:61 Connection refused
Oct 20 10:57:18 Nicks-MacBook-Pro.local ntpd[239]: dnssd_clientstub ConnectToServer: connect() failed path:/var/run/mDNSResponder Socket:3 Err:-1 Errno:61 Connection refused
Oct 20 10:57:19 Nicks-MacBook-Pro.local configd[25]: dnssd_clientstub ConnectToServer: connect() failed path:/var/run/mDNSResponder Socket:8 Err:-1 Errno:61 Connection refused
Oct 20 10:57:21 Nicks-MacBook-Pro.local ntpd[239]: dnssd_clientstub ConnectToServer: connect() failed path:/var/run/mDNSResponder Socket:3 Err:-1 Errno:61 Connection refused
Oct 20 10:57:23 Nicks-MacBook-Pro.local configd[25]: dnssd_clientstub ConnectToServer: connect() failed path:/var/run/mDNSResponder Socket:8 Err:-1 Errno:61 Connection refused

크롬은 여전히 ​​잘 작동하지만 (크롬에 별도의 리졸버가 있습니까?) 파이어 폭스가 그렇지 않으면 dig google.com올바른 결과를 반환합니다.

나는 ISP의 DNS 서버뿐만 아니라 8.8.8.8/ 8.8.4.4차이없이 시도했습니다 .

매우 이상한 점은 다시 시작하면 다시 발생하기 전에 몇 분 동안 훌륭한 성능을 얻을 수 있다는 것입니다.

어떤 아이디어?

최신 정보

분명히 언로드 /로드 가 잠시 동안 discoveryd작동하기 시작하면 (과거의 지침이 언로드 /로드되었습니다 mDNSResponder) :

sudo launchctl unload -w /System/Library/LaunchDaemons/com.apple.discoveryd.plist
sudo launchctl load -w /System/Library/LaunchDaemons/com.apple.discoveryd.plist

이것이로드 / 언로드 후 콘솔에있는 것입니다. 관련이 무엇인지 모릅니다.

10/20/14 4:44:08.268 PM discoveryd[1333]: Basic Sockets GetProcessNameFromSocket() failed errno[57] err[-1]
10/20/14 4:44:08.268 PM discoveryd[1333]: Basic Sockets Unknown(-1), errno 0 UDS FD=3
10/20/14 4:44:08.268 PM discoveryd[1333]: Basic Sockets UDS FD=3 ERROR: failed to get effective user ID, errno 0
10/20/14 4:44:08.268 PM discoveryd[1333]: Basic SleepProxy BSP Server Disabled. Metric = 3373
10/20/14 4:44:08.272 PM discoveryd[1333]: AwdlD2d AwdlD2dInitialize: Initialized
10/20/14 4:44:08.273 PM discoveryd[1333]: D2D_IPC: Loaded
10/20/14 4:44:08.273 PM airportd[29]: _resetD2DConnection: Connection re-established to mDNSResponder D2D server
10/20/14 4:44:08.275 PM discoveryd_helper[254]: Detailed RemoteControl com.apple.discoveryd_helper XPC connection 0x7fa853800680: start (pid=1333, <unknown> not root)
10/20/14 4:44:08.277 PM configd[25]: network changed.
10/20/14 4:44:08.282 PM discoveryd[1333]: Basic RemoteControl com.apple.discoveryd Starting XPC Server
10/20/14 4:44:08.282 PM discoveryd[1333]: Basic DNSResolver etc/hosts file changed: Event 0x7ffab6b005e0 Flushed /etc/hosts cache
10/20/14 4:44:08.283 PM discoveryd[1333]: Basic RemoteControl com.apple.discoveryd.dnsproxy Starting XPC Server
10/20/14 4:44:08.283 PM discoveryd[1333]: AwdlD2d AwdlD2dStartAdvertisingPair: 'nicks-macbook-pro' Advertising service started
10/20/14 4:44:08.283 PM discoveryd[1333]: Basic SleepProxy Sleep Proxy Server is not enabled
10/20/14 4:44:08.284 PM discoveryd[1333]: AwdlD2d AwdlD2dStartAdvertisingPair: 'nicks-macbook-pro' Advertising service started
10/20/14 4:44:08.285 PM discoveryd[1333]: AwdlD2d AwdlD2dStartAdvertisingPair: '483e5cefffa5108400000000000008efip6arpa' Advertising service started
10/20/14 4:44:08.286 PM discoveryd[1333]: AwdlD2d AwdlD2dStopAdvertisingPair: 'nicks-macbook-pro' Advertising service stopped
10/20/14 4:44:08.286 PM discoveryd[1333]: AwdlD2d AwdlD2dStopAdvertisingPair: 'nicks-macbook-pro' Advertising service stopped
10/20/14 4:44:08.287 PM discoveryd[1333]: AwdlD2d AwdlD2dStartAdvertisingPair: 'nicks-macbook-pro' Advertising service started
10/20/14 4:44:08.287 PM discoveryd[1333]: AwdlD2d AwdlD2dStartAdvertisingPair: 'nicks-macbook-pro' Advertising service started
10/20/14 4:44:08.288 PM discoveryd[1333]: AwdlD2d AwdlD2dStopAdvertisingPair: '483e5cefffa5108400000000000008efip6arpa' Advertising service stopped
10/20/14 4:44:08.289 PM discoveryd[1333]: AwdlD2d AwdlD2dStartAdvertisingPair: '483e5cefffa5108400000000000008efip6arpa' Advertising service started

그래도 계속 진행하기 위해 너무 자주 언로드 /로드해야합니다. 이 문제의 원인은 무엇입니까?


1
나는이 같은 문제를 겪고 있으며 화를 내고 있습니다. 아파치 나 MySQL을 제대로 작동시킬 수조차 없다.
Andrew

달리면 어떻게 dscacheutil -configuration되나요? 나는 / etc / hosts의 끝없는 재로드가 이것과 관련이 있다고 생각합니다. superuser.com/questions/829383/…
Andrew

답변:


8

긴 샷이지만 Adium과 함께 Bonjour 계정을 사용합니까? https://trac.adium.im/ticket/16827

OP업데이트 는 이것이 문제임을 나타냅니다.

문제가 Adium에서 Bonjour 메시징을 사용하도록 설정 한 것으로 나타났습니다. 이 문제를 해결하기 위해 언로드 /로드 검색을 수행하고 Adium으로 이동하여 bonjour를 비활성화 한 다음 아무런 문제없이 다시 시작했습니다. 봉쥬르를 원하면로드 / 언로드 발견을 찾거나 위의 Adium 티켓이 처리 될 때까지 기다리십시오.


와우 ... adium에서 bonjour를 비활성화 한 상태에서 다시 시작하면 bonjour 네트워킹을 다시 활성화하는 즉시 네트워킹을 즉시 종료하고 (버그에 설명 된 것처럼) 최대 discoveryd100 % 램프 를 내렸다가 언로드 /로드해야합니다. 내가 장애인을 유지하는 한 나는 모두 좋다. 감사!
Nick

이 문제는 adium을 전혀 설치하지 않은 사용자에게도 발생합니다. 활동 모니터를 통해 발견 된로드 / 언로드가 발견되지 않거나 해당 프로세스를 종료하지 않는 솔루션이 있습니까?
Jan Michael

1
발견 된 프로세스가 중단되기까지 간헐적 인 시간이 있으므로 위에서 언급 한 Adium 연결이 결정적이라고 생각하지 않습니다. 내 생각에 Adium에서 bonjour 옵션을 전환하면 프로세스를 종료하는 것과 비슷한 발견에 일시적인 영향을 미칩니다. 나는 Adium을 실행하지 않으며 위의 포스터와 마찬가지로 CPU 사용량이 100 % 이상 증가하고 DNS 이름을 확인할 수 없다는 것과 동일한 문제가 있습니다. Network Prefs 내에서 DNS 서버를 변경해도 장기적인 영향은 없지만 검색이 새로 고쳐 지므로

1
이 기사는 나를 올바르게 진행시켰다. 나는 adium을 사용하지 않지만 업그레이드 후에도 여전히 com.apple.mDNSResponder.plist가 남아 있음을 발견했습니다. com.apple.mDNSResponder.plist, com.apple.mDNSResponderHelper.plist를 압축 해제하고 재부팅하면 OSX DNS가 제대로 작동합니다.

내 dnsreponser plists는 모두 이미 사라졌습니다. 문제가 지속됩니다.
Kees de Kooter
당사 사이트를 사용함과 동시에 당사의 쿠키 정책개인정보 보호정책을 읽고 이해하였음을 인정하는 것으로 간주합니다.
Licensed under cc by-sa 3.0 with attribution required.